Hitch Mounted Bike Rack Suggestions

Can anyone help me pick out a Bike Rack for my hitch, looking for something that will hold 2 canal bikes w/ baskets, a decent locking system (bikes and to truck), and folds down w/ bikes on to access tailgate. It gets confusing looking online, looking for some first hand experience, Thanks.

I've got a Yakima Bighorn 4 on the back of the camper. It just about fits 2 cruisers with baskets. It folds down when you pull a pin, but I never use that with my application. It's a little on the heavy side, and one of the top support bars seems to have gotten bent somehow (doesn't effect function). Lists for $200, I got it for 1/2 price during a Sports Authority sale.

Whichever bike rack you choose beware of the alignment at the weld point between the lower horizontal bar coming from the hitch and the vertical bar. If these two bars at this intersection are not perfectly aligned then the top end of the vertical bar will be off centered or slanted.
